Hey guys. Sorry for a stupid question, but how long is the stock track bar (center of joint to center of joint)?

I have a 95 Dakota On top of Dana 60s from a 94 2500 hd and my track bar has been sleeved and extended to 37". Well, the joint on the end is bad, and i'm looking to get one with serviceable ends that i wont need to have extended.

May wanna have a look at doing a conversion to a third gen style track bar. It has bushings on both ends, so, basically never wears out. They are also available in adjustable flavors, which would work rather nicely for you. Just get one that will go a couple inches either side of the 37 inches you need.
